Randolph included among U.S. News & World Report’s Best Colleges

Randolph College was once again ranked among the nation’s top liberal arts colleges by one of the nation’s most recognizable college guidebooks. Randolph was ranked among the top national liberal arts colleges in the 2018 edition of U.S. News & World Report’s Best Colleges.

The 2018 rankings of the U.S. News & World Report include data from more than 1,100 accredited four-year schools, comparing them by a set of indicators of excellence including peer assessment, graduation and retention rates, faculty resources, student selectivity, financial resources, and alumni giving, graduation rate performance, and high school counselor ratings.

The College was also recognized in The Princeton Review’s 2018 edition of The Best 382 Colleges, and College Values Online ranked Randolph’s faculty in the top 50 in the nation among small colleges. In addition, Randolph was sixth in Virginia in College Factual’s “Best Colleges for the Money” rankings, and Money magazine named Randolph one of its “Best Colleges for Your Money 2017.”
